After I complete my phlebotomy training program in Santa Rosa, what is the career outlook?
The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ics expects excellent job growth for clinical laboratory workers with employment opportunities in the field expected to grow by 14 percent between 2008 and 2018. Growth for this career field has been spurred by the increased volume of laboratory tests due to population growth and the continual development of new types of tests.*
